Ingredients make Cheese garlic bread
- It's 4 cloves garlic, crushed.
- Prepare 2 tablespoons butter.
- Prepare 2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il.
- It's 1 loaf crusty bread, split.
- Prepare 3 tablespoons grated cheese, Parmigiano or Romano, optional.
- Prepare as required Chopped fresh parsley.
Cheese garlic bread step by step
- Combine garlic, butter, and oil in a microwave-safe dish or in a small saucepan. Heat garlic and butter and oil in the microwave for 1 minute or in a small pot over moderate-low heat for 3 minutes..
- Toast split bread under the broiler. Remove bread when it is toasted golden brown in colour. Brush bread liberally with garlic oil. Sprinkle with cheese, if using, and parsley. If you added cheese, return to broiler and brown 30 seconds. Cut into chunks and serve..
- Your garlic bread is ready.
